Equipment and Materials for Fiber Optic Fusion Splicing

Equipment and Materials for Fiber Optic Fusion Splicing

Essential fiber optic fusion splicing equipment includes fusion splicers, cleavers, protection sleeves, stripping and cleaning tools, inspection devices, and related accessories.Core Fusion Splicing EquipmentFusion Splicers: Devices that join two optical fibers end-to-end using precise thermal fusion. Popular models include Fujikura 90S+, INNO View 8+, and Sumitomo Type-72C+, offering features like core alignment, fast splice times, and automated calibration for single-fiber or ribbon fiber splicing .Fiber Cleavers: Tools for producing precise, perpendicular fiber cuts. Single-fiber cleavers are suitable for repairs, while ribbon cleavers allow multiple fibers to be cleaved simultaneously .Stripping Tools: Multi-hole strippers calibrated for 250µm bare fibers or 900µm coated fibers, provided by brands like Jonard, Fujikura, and INNO, ensure safe removal of fiber coatings without damaging the glass core .Protection and Handling MaterialsFusion-Protection Sleeves: Heat-shrink or mechanical sleeves that protect the splice point and maintain mechanical strength .Splice-On Connectors: Pre-terminated connectors for 900µm or 3.0mm fibers, including accessories for installation .Mechanical Splices: Alternative to fusion splicing for temporary or low-loss connections .Cleaning and Inspection ToolsFiber Cleaning Tools: Lint-free wipes, 99%+ isopropyl alcohol, fiber cleaning pens, and optical-grade cleaning fluids to remove dust, oil, or gel residues .Inspection Microscopes and Cameras: Visual inspection systems, low-power microscopes, or built-in splicer cameras to verify cleave quality and cleanliness .Fiber Cleave Analyzers: Interferometric devices for precise measurement of cleaved fiber end faces .Auxiliary Equipment and AccessoriesRecoating and Proof Testing Tools: For restoring fiber coating and testing splice strength .Laser Cutters and Epoxy Curing Ovens: Used in connector preparation and fiber shaping .Enclosures and Splice Trays: Wall-mount or rack-mount enclosures, splice trays, and MPO breakout cassettes for organized fiber management .OTDRs and Test Equipment: Optical Time Domain Reflectometers, power meters, light sources, and visual fault locators for testing splice quality and network performance .Recommended Brands and SuppliersThorlabs (Vytran®): Fusion splicers, cleavers, fiber processors, and inspection systems .Fiber Optic Center: Equipment from Corning, AFL, Sumitomo, 3M, 3SAE, Fitel .Amerifiber: Top-rated fusion splicers and ribbon splicing solutions .Fiber Instrument Sales: Comprehensive splicing kits, accessories, and enclosures .This list covers the full spectrum of fiber optic fusion splicing equipment and materials, from core splicing devices to cleaning, inspection, and protective accessories, suitable for professional installations, maintenance, and high-density network environments.
